
It is no secret that Mamelodi Sundowns boast the most valuable squad in the DStv Premiership; however, how does the Brazilians’ squad compare to Kaizer Chiefs and Orlando Pirates in millions?
Sundowns’ dominance in the league has been clear. The Brazilians have won the last five consecutive PSL titles and are well on course to lift a sixth in the 2022/23 season.

In addition to their local dominance, they have firmly established themselves as a force on the continent, where they managed to win the CAF Champions League in 2016.
Sundowns’ prowess shows a paradigm shift in power from perennial giants Chiefs and Pirates. While the three sides are often mentioned in the same breath as the country’s ‘Big three’, there is a considerable gap between them when it comes to their values on Transfermarkt.com.
According to Transfermarkt, Rulani Mokwena’s Sundowns squad have a market value of €25.5m (±R476m), the highest of any squad in South Africa.
Their Soweto counterparts lag behind the Chloorkop outfit with Orlando Pirates boasting the second most valuable squad with a market value of €16.7m (±R311m).
Chiefs, who have spent quite significantly at the start of the campaign boast the third most valuable squad in the league. Their market value estimated around €12.7m (±R237m).
Sundowns’ most valuable player, Peter Shalulile, has an impressive €2m (±R37m) market value, while for Chiefs, their vice-captain Keagan Dolly ranks as their most valuable player at €1.3m (±R24m). Pirates’ most valuable player is Deon Hotto with a market value of €1m (±R18m).
